AN ANTHOLOGY has been released of Lake District literary extracts.
It is a tribute to the beauty of a countryside landscape that has inspired authors for generations.
'A String of Pearls: Landscape and Literature of the Lake District' has been compiled by Margaret Wilson, with photographs by Helen Shaw.
